I had a few more questions of my own for Dr. Dean, so here they are along with her answers:

Q: Can you take the bentonite/psyllium/caprylic acid mixture if you are experiencing intestinal bleeding?

A: I don’t think the psyllium would be good in bleeding…and probably not the caprylic acid. Wait until you’ve had no bleeding for several weeks before you begin.

Q: Likewise, can you take the phosphatidyl choline if you are having intestinal bleeding?

A: Yes, there seems to be no problem there.

Q: Lastly, would you still have good results if you left out the psyllium from the bentonite/psyllium/caprylic acid mixture (many don’t tolerate it) and just used bentonite and caprylic acid?

A: Ah, I add aloe when I take out the psyllium. Didn’t get to that part!!
